What is Kinesiology?
The multidisciplinary study of physical activity or movement
What are the three planes?
Sagittal, Tranverse, Frontal
Name one fracture that can only occur with children
Greenstick fracture
Classifications for all joints
Synathroses, Amphiathroses, Diathroses
Difference between posterior and anterior
Posterior refers to a structure that is behind another structure. Anterior refers to a structure that is in front of another structure.

How can a nerve injury occur?
Pulling, stretching, or cutting of the nerve
Example of amphiathroses joint
Ribs, sternum, pubic symphysis
Swelling in the tissue
Edema
What is a synapse?
A synapse is the space between adjacent neurons through which an impulse is transmitted.
